Ultrasound-Guided needle shots ease shoulder pain better?

NCT ID NCT06222710

First seen Mar 12, 2026 · Last updated May 22, 2026 · Updated 14 times

Summary

This study tested whether using ultrasound to guide a needle during pharmacopuncture therapy helps reduce shoulder pain more than the usual method without ultrasound. Forty adults with moderate to severe shoulder pain from a torn rotator cuff tendon took part. The goal was to see if the ultrasound-guided approach leads to better pain relief and shoulder function.
